Technology Components:
|
•
A specially designed handheld computer, which stores
family data for 2 to 3 villages.
• Handheld has a built-in printer for
printing receipts in the field and it operates
on a battery. • It hasGSM&
PSTN modems to send data on the respective networks
to centralized database.
• In-built Smart Card reader/writer.
• Centralized server inDMHOOffice to
synchronize data from field.
• A web portal displays data on query
and consolidated immunisation
reports. • Desktop computers
in PHCs are enabled with Smart Card
reading and facilitated with ‘e-Immunisation’
